Output e8f7862a926331eb85a1b0faa92fbe00ebfa1a49bfb97355fc84eb61abc7964c:4

value
56670882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2df8283b2ffe0f01694c193b2770ab3eb3cdc1 OP_EQUAL
address
MDZwCL9ybgHZrYQzPb1NP1omyQCmXDgazD
transaction
e8f7862a926331eb85a1b0faa92fbe00ebfa1a49bfb97355fc84eb61abc7964c
spent
true